Analysis
In 2024, energy self-reliance in Sweden stood at 52.3%.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 0.4% over ten years.
Over the whole period, energy self-reliance in Sweden peaked at 54.5% in 2019 and was at its lowest, 47.2%, in 2003.
Sweden ranks 4th of 27 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 50.8% | 49.3% | 53.0% | 10 |
| 2000s | 49.5% | 47.2% | 51.8% | 10 |
| 2010s | 51.1% | 47.8% | 54.5% | 10 |
| 2020s | 51.9% | 50.8% | 52.6% | 5 |
